What to Expect from Your Madeira Scuba Experience

My first scuba dive in the Ocean from Madeira - What to Expect from Your Madeira Scuba Experience

This “first-time scuba” tour balances safety, education, and fun, ensuring you get a genuine taste of the underwater world without feeling overwhelmed. The activity begins with a comprehensive briefing by your instructor, who will explain basic safety concepts, introduce the scuba gear, and answer any initial questions. It’s reassuring to know that the instructor’s focus is on your safety and comfort—an important factor when trying something for the first time.

After the briefing, you’ll don your gear onshore, getting familiar with the equipment. The whole process is designed to build confidence before heading out onto the boat, which shuttles you to the designated dive spot within the Garajau Marine Reserve. The boat ride itself is a pleasant 15-20 minutes, offering scenic views of Madeira’s coast.

The Underwater Adventure

Once you arrive at the dive site, your instructor will accompany you into the water, which will reach depths of up to 12 meters. Don’t worry—you’ll be under constant supervision. The Equipment and Safety

All necessary equipment is included—mask, fins, wetsuit, and regulator—meaning you don’t have to worry about bringing anything special. The gear is reportedly in good condition and suitable for beginners, helping you feel more at ease.

The tour emphasizes safety, with instructors guiding every step, from entry to exit. Visuals and Marine Life

The Garajau Marine Reserve is a protected area, which means the marine environment is preserved and teeming with life. Expect to see schools of fish, colorful reefs, and maybe even some larger marine species. The clarity of the water allows for excellent visibility, making it a visual feast that keeps your attention captivated.

The Practicalities

My first scuba dive in the Ocean from Madeira - The Practicalities

Duration and Schedule

The whole experience lasts around 4 hours, including briefing, gear-up time, boat transfer, and the actual dive. Starting times vary, so checking availability in advance is important. The activity can be tailored to your schedule, with multiple slots available throughout the day.

Pricing and Value

At $171 per person, the experience is competitively priced, especially considering that it includes equipment rental, a professional instructor, and the boat transfer. For those contemplating a potential future certification, this is a cost-effective way to get a taste of diving without the commitment of a full course.

Meeting Point and Transportation

You’ll meet at the dive centre, with the exact location provided upon booking. If you’re not staying nearby, transportation can be arranged, but it’s not included in the price. Travelers have noted that the meeting point is easy to find and well-organized.

Language and Communication

Guides speak several languages, including English, Portuguese, Spanish, and French, making it accessible to a wide range of travelers. This multilingual approach helps ensure clarity and comfort throughout the experience.
